The Catalog Records Accordion gives you the option of entering items from the Accession screen at the time the accession is registered. You can also specify the type of acquisition, such as gift, bequest, purchase, transfer, or exchange, and track activities throughout the accession process.Įvery item in your collection is linked to its source information by its accession number. With PastPerfect, you may enter complete information about each new accession, including donor name and address, date received and accessioned, names of staff who received and accessioned items, and credit line. Accurate and complete accession records are the cornerstones of museum collections. ![]()
